The Immediate Aftermath: What Happens Right After Liposuction?
Right after your liposuction procedure, you'll experience some discomfort, swelling, and bruising, which are all part of the normal healing process. These side effects can vary in intensity depending on the amount of fat removed and the area treated. Most people are able to return home the same day, though you’ll need someone to drive you. It’s essential to follow your post-operative instructions closely to avoid complications and ensure the best results.

You'll likely be given compression garments to wear, which are designed to help reduce swelling and support the skin as it adapts to its new contours. These garments also help in reducing discomfort and provide a smoother look after the procedure. Wearing them as instructed is crucial for minimizing swelling and helping the skin fit snugly over the treated area.

Swelling and Bruising: How Long Does It Last?
One of the most common concerns after liposuction is how long swelling and bruising will last. Typically, swelling begins to subside after a few days, but it can take weeks to fully see the contours of your body. Bruising is also common and may last anywhere from a few days to two weeks, depending on your individual healing process. During this time, it’s vital to take it easy and avoid strenuous physical activities.

Although the visible bruising may subside relatively quickly, the internal swelling can take several months to resolve. The body continues to heal in stages, and it’s common for the final results to become apparent around 3 to 6 months after surgery.

Managing Pain and Discomfort
Pain after liposuction can vary from person to person, but most people report mild to moderate discomfort. Doctors typically prescribe pain medications to help you manage the pain, especially in the first few days after surgery. Over-the-counter pain relievers may also be effective once you’re past the initial recovery period. Be sure to communicate with your medical provider if you feel the pain is not being adequately managed or if you experience any unusual symptoms.

Resuming Physical Activities: When Can You Get Back to Your Routine?
After liposuction, it’s crucial to rest and allow your body time to heal. Your medical provider will guide you on when to gradually resume activities. While you’ll need to avoid strenuous exercise for about 4 to 6 weeks, light walking is encouraged to improve circulation and promote healing. Avoid activities that might strain the treated areas, like heavy lifting or intense cardio, until you're given the green light by your provider.

Long-Term Results: How Soon Will You See Final Results?
It’s essential to keep in mind that the full benefits of liposuction might not be immediately visible. As swelling continues to reduce, the results of your procedure will become clearer. The skin will gradually tighten, and the body’s new shape will be more defined over time. Most patients start to notice significant changes around the 3-month mark, but it can take up to 6 months or longer for the final results to emerge.

In the meantime, maintaining a healthy lifestyle with a balanced diet and regular exercise is key to ensuring that the results last. Liposuction removes fat cells, but it doesn't prevent you from gaining weight in the future. Maintaining your weight will help you enjoy the results for years to come.

Risks and Potential Complications
Like any surgical procedure, liposuction carries some risks, although serious complications are rare. Some possible risks include infection, blood clots, skin irregularities, and asymmetry. It’s essential to carefully follow all post-operative instructions and attend follow-up appointments to minimize these risks. Your medical team will monitor your progress and provide guidance on managing any complications that may arise.

Tips for a Smooth Recovery
To ensure the best possible recovery after liposuction, consider these helpful tips:

Follow All Aftercare Instructions: Whether it’s wearing compression garments or avoiding specific activities, following your doctor's instructions is vital to the healing process.
Stay Hydrated: Drinking plenty of water helps reduce swelling and supports the healing process.
Eat Well: Focus on eating nutritious foods that aid in recovery. High-protein foods can help with healing, and staying hydrated is essential.
Be Patient: Results take time, and while it’s tempting to rush back into physical activities, give yourself the time you need to heal fully.
Stay Positive: The healing process can take time, but remember that each step you take is part of achieving your desired look.
